Output 95b762a545691dac1966814a94b6f9a806f20099884891d95ad6c904b9970e1e:0

value
6053850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e6052593d0255e5605929792c6719235770766e OP_EQUALVERIFY OP_CHECKSIG
address
189R6WaiTEdhuNtK3vnv5QA1e3oTYxodGH
transaction
95b762a545691dac1966814a94b6f9a806f20099884891d95ad6c904b9970e1e
spent
true